Learning Outcome Assessment Criteria
1. erect and dismantle basic cantilever scaffolds 1.1 use and maintain hand tools, ancillary equipment and access equipment
1.2 identify and confirm the area in which to erect the cantilever scaffold
1.3 confirm the stability of foundation/structure on which the scaffold will be erected and secured
1.4 confirm the materials and component makeup, including: tube and fitting, systems scaffold
1.5 set out and prepare for the scaffold structure
1.6 erect and secure the scaffold in accordance with techniques and practices for cantilevered scaffold structure incorporating access for erection or use of other occupations
1.7 dismantle and remove cantilever scaffold structure
1.8 check and test the fall arrest equipment for security, safety and operational movement
1.9 complete the work within the allocated time, in accordance with the programme of work
